I soaked a lot of rocks in muriatic acid and when I'm done I just put the rocks in a bucket of water. I have never needed to use baking soda. Just rinsed them off well is all and where the proper gloves so you don't get anything on your skin along with goggles
The muriatic is still in the cracks if you don't use baking soda. I also soak them in Iron out after the acid process.
